Default Cardle: "Critics should give me a break"

Quote:
Matt Cardle has hit out at Biffy Clyro fans who have criticised his cover version of the band's single 'Many Of Horror'.

Cardle released the single under the new name 'When We Collide' after being crowned this year's X Factor champion last weekend.

"I leapt at the chance to do it because it's not your average winner's song," Cardle explained to BBC News. "It's not cheesy and I'm sorry if I've ruined it for people, but it's credible.

"I understand why there will be a backlash, but give me a break," Cardle added.

'When We Collide' is expected to top the UK singles chart this weekend to become Christmas number one.
